AAP begins first phase of campaign

The party has unveiled its first set of posters and hoardings. The theme of the campaign material is to remind the people of Delhi that the BJP’s central government has been ruling Delhi through the backdoor since the month of May and cannot escape the responsibility for the unjustified hike in electricity and water tariffs. Meanwhile, AAP leader Arvind Kejriwal on Wednesday claimed to win the full majority in the forthcoming Delhi elections.

‘With the BJP’s central government having been forced to finally take the much delayed decision of dissolving the Delhi assembly after a gap of eight months, AAP has now started the first phase of its campaign for the fresh assembly elections,’ said Kejriwal. The party unveiled its first set of posters and hoardings, in which it has appealed to the people of Delhi to compare the performance of Kejriwal’s 49 days of governance in Delhi to that of first 150 days of Narendra Modi government at the Centre.

There has been a rise in the levels of corruption in the national Capital, which has increased the sufferings of the people under an unresponsive and unaccountable Delhi administration.

‘This initial phase of campaign will set the tone for party’s main theme of making Delhi India’s first corruption free state and a world class city through honest governance, which the AAP alone can provide’, said the spokesperson.
